TEHRAN - Security authorities in Iran say they detained more than 260 people on the anniversary of Jina Mahsa Amini's death, according to local media, as authorities issued a heavy crackdown to avoid renewed protests.

The 260 arrests were made in the space of 24 hours, and on the anniversary of some of Iran's largest protests in recent history, German news agency (dpa) quoted the report by Shargh newspaper on Sunday.

Security authorities said the arrests were made due to violations of public security, inciting protests and possession of weapons.

The death of the 22-year-old Iranian Kurdish woman Amini, arrested by the morality police for allegedly flouting mandatory dress codes, marked its first anniversary on Saturday. Her death in custody triggered a wave of violent protests across Iran in late 2022.

Ahead of the anniversary, Iranian forces had taken strict security measures to prevent a renewed wave of marches. - BERNAMAQ-dpa
